Ham with Rhubarb Sauce

Servings: 8
Ingredients:
1 (4 lb) boneless ham, cooked
1/2 cup water
3 cups chopped rhubarb
1 1/4 cups sugar
1/3 cup orange juice
2 teaspoons grated orange rind
3/4 teaspoon dry mustard
1 cinnamon stick
Directions:
1. Put ham on a rack in a shallow roasting pan.
2. Add water and cover with foil.
3. Roast at 325 degrees until meat thermometer registers 135 degrees.
4. In the meantime combine remaining ingredients and bring to a boil.
5. Reduce heat to medium and cook, uncovered, about 15 minutes; stir occasionally.
6. Remove cinnamon stick.
7. The last 15 minutes of baking time, remove foil from ham and spoon small amount of sauce over the ham (return to oven for remaining time).
8. Remove and allow ham to stand, covered, about 10 minutes.
9. Serve remaining sauce with ham.
